      Meaning of the first name Celinde

      Origin

      Greek, possibly Celtic.

      Meaning

      Celinde means "moon" or "heavenly."
      The name Celinde has its roots in various linguistic traditions, predominantly associated with the Greek language. Deriving from the Greek word "keline," which relates to the concept of "light" or "brightness," the name embodies a sense of illumination and clarity. The modern adaptation of Celinde may also be linked to the Latin "celinda," which translates to "heavenly" or "divine." This duality in meaning emphasizes both a connection to brightness and a celestial quality, rendering the name significant in various cultural contexts.
